Overcoming the disadvantages of equidistant discretization of continuous actions, we introduce an approach that separates time into slices of varying length bordered by certain events. Such events are points in time at which the equations describing the system’s behavior—that is, the equations which specify the ongoing processes—change. The main concern of this thesis is the formal reasoning about reactive systems, that is, systems that repeatedly act and react in interaction with their environment without necessarily terminating. When describing such systems the focus is not on what is computed but rather on the interaction capabilities over time.
